X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?a=blobdiff_plain;f=opendaylight%2Fmd-sal%2Fsal-dom-broker%2Fsrc%2Fmain%2Fjava%2Forg%2Fopendaylight%2Fcontroller%2Fmd%2Fsal%2Fdom%2Fbroker%2Fimpl%2FTransactionCommitFailedExceptionMapper.java;h=76bf549bf058c0343df0a319ccb2af17dc3304d2;hb=3859df9beca8f13f1ff2b2744ed3470a1715bec3;hp=799a8a09edc3144b78896c0dc3a64f0603572d45;hpb=10948fbda7e6d997525cce5b4929a1e426045c52;p=controller.git diff --git a/opendaylight/md-sal/sal-dom-broker/src/main/java/org/opendaylight/controller/md/sal/dom/broker/impl/TransactionCommitFailedExceptionMapper.java b/opendaylight/md-sal/sal-dom-broker/src/main/java/org/opendaylight/controller/md/sal/dom/broker/impl/TransactionCommitFailedExceptionMapper.java index 799a8a09ed..76bf549bf0 100644 --- a/opendaylight/md-sal/sal-dom-broker/src/main/java/org/opendaylight/controller/md/sal/dom/broker/impl/TransactionCommitFailedExceptionMapper.java +++ b/opendaylight/md-sal/sal-dom-broker/src/main/java/org/opendaylight/controller/md/sal/dom/broker/impl/TransactionCommitFailedExceptionMapper.java @@ -7,6 +7,7 @@ */ package org.opendaylight.controller.md.sal.dom.broker.impl; +import edu.umd.cs.findbugs.annotations.SuppressFBWarnings; import org.opendaylight.controller.md.sal.common.api.data.TransactionCommitFailedException; import org.opendaylight.yangtools.util.concurrent.ExceptionMapper; @@ -15,25 +16,31 @@ import org.opendaylight.yangtools.util.concurrent.ExceptionMapper; * * @see ExceptionMapper */ -final class TransactionCommitFailedExceptionMapper - extends ExceptionMapper { +@Deprecated +public final class TransactionCommitFailedExceptionMapper extends ExceptionMapper { - static final TransactionCommitFailedExceptionMapper PRE_COMMIT_MAPPER = create("canCommit"); + public static final TransactionCommitFailedExceptionMapper PRE_COMMIT_MAPPER = create("preCommit"); - static final TransactionCommitFailedExceptionMapper CAN_COMMIT_ERROR_MAPPER = create("preCommit"); + public static final TransactionCommitFailedExceptionMapper CAN_COMMIT_ERROR_MAPPER = create("canCommit"); - static final TransactionCommitFailedExceptionMapper COMMIT_ERROR_MAPPER = create("commit"); + public static final TransactionCommitFailedExceptionMapper COMMIT_ERROR_MAPPER = create("commit"); private TransactionCommitFailedExceptionMapper(final String opName) { - super( opName, TransactionCommitFailedException.class ); + super(opName, TransactionCommitFailedException.class); } - public static final TransactionCommitFailedExceptionMapper create(final String opName) { + public static TransactionCommitFailedExceptionMapper create(final String opName) { return new TransactionCommitFailedExceptionMapper(opName); } @Override - protected TransactionCommitFailedException newWithCause( String message, Throwable cause ) { - return new TransactionCommitFailedException( message, cause ); + protected TransactionCommitFailedException newWithCause(final String message, final Throwable cause) { + return new TransactionCommitFailedException(message, cause); } -} \ No newline at end of file + + @Override + @SuppressFBWarnings("BC_UNCONFIRMED_CAST_OF_RETURN_VALUE") + public TransactionCommitFailedException apply(Exception input) { + return super.apply(input); + } +}